Dit is de officiële documentatie website voor Lowlands Tactical, gebouwd met VitePress.
- Node.js 18 of hoger
- npm (komt met Node.js)
- Clone de repository:
git clone https://github.com/yourusername/lt-wiki.git
cd lt-wiki
- Installeer dependencies:
npm install
- Start de ontwikkelserver:
npm run docs:dev
- Open je browser en ga naar
http://localhost:5173
Om de site voor productie te bouwen:
npm run docs:build
De gebouwde bestanden zullen in de dist
map staan.
-
Maak een nieuw markdown bestand aan in de juiste map onder
docs/
:docs/algemene-informatie/
voor algemene informatiedocs/tactische-syllabus/
voor tactische syllabusdocs/specialisaties/
voor specialisatiesdocs/missiemakers/
voor missie maker handleidingen
-
Voeg de nieuwe pagina toe aan de navigatie in
docs/.vitepress/config.ts
:- Voeg toe aan de
nav
array voor top navigatie - Voeg toe aan de
sidebar
array voor zijbalk navigatie
- Voeg toe aan de
docs/
├── .vitepress/
│ ├── config.ts # Site configuratie
│ └── theme/ # Aangepast thema (indien aanwezig)
├── public/ # Statische bestanden
├── algemene-informatie/
├── tactische-syllabus/
├── specialisaties/
└── missiemakers/
- Frontmatter: Elk markdown bestand moet beginnen met:
---
layout: doc
title: Jouw Pagina Titel
---
- Afbeeldingen: Plaats afbeeldingen in de
docs/public
map en verwijs ernaar met absolute paden:

- Links: Gebruik relatieve paden voor interne links:
[Link tekst](/pad/naar/pagina)
- Maak een nieuwe branch aan voor je wijzigingen
- Maak je wijzigingen
- Test lokaal met
npm run docs:dev
- Dien een pull request in
- Wacht op review en goedkeuring
- Gebouwd met VitePress 1.0.0
- Gebruikt Node.js 18+
- Automatisch gedeployed naar GitHub Pages
Dit project is gelicenseerd onder de MIT Licentie - zie het LICENSE bestand voor details.